Introducing Gouda, a delightful girl who is just waiting to find her forever home! This sweet pup is house trained and ready to be your companion in all of life's adventures. While she may feel a bit anxious when meeting new people, she quickly warms up once she feels safe and loved.

Gouda has a wonderful background, having grown up with children from crawling babies to 10-year-olds, making her a great fit for family environments. She's also been around other dogs and even two cats, one of whom was her playful buddy! Gouda is a fun-loving girl who can be rambunctious at times, but she's just as happy to relax and enjoy some quiet time, embracing her inner "couch potato."

Unfortunately, Gouda was returned to us due to a change in her owner's housing situation. After staying with family for a few months, she has become a bit more anxious, but we believe that with the right love and patience, she will regain her trust and confidence. At our facility, Gouda shows her sweet side while also showing signs of anxiety, and we are hopeful she will thrive in a loving foster or adoptive home where she can feel secure.

If you're looking for a sweet companion who's ready to give and receive love, Gouda could be the perfect match for you! With a little extra understanding and support, we know she has the potential to blossom into an incredible family member. Come meet Gouda and discover the joy she can bring to your life!

Gouda was born September 2022

Included with adoption: Age-appropriate vaccinations, up-to-date on heart-worm and flea/tick preventative, heartworm test which includes tick disease testing (if over 6 months), 24Petwatch microchip with registration, fecal analysis and health check before adoption, and spayed or neutered-if not already, a voucher is provided which will cover the cost. If you are adopting a puppy all puppy vaccines are covered as well.

More about this rescue

We are a 501c organization that saves pets from high kill shelters, off the streets and also accept pets as owner surrenders so they do not have to step a foot in the shelters. We believe all animals deserve a good life and we strive to give them one! We give them any medical attention they may need, including spay/neuters, a microchip and vaccinations and find them a forever home.
